The value of a building bought in 1990 appreciates, or increases, as time passes 13 years after the building was bought it was worth $160,000, 14 years after it was bought it was worth $170,000
a. If this relationship between number of years past 1990 and value of building is finear, write an equation describing this relationship. Use ordered pairs of the form (years past 1900, value of building). Let x represent the number of years since
1990 and y represent the value of the building
b. Use this equation to estimate the value of the building in the year 2010
